From c48056710a4ca6a6e52be60b0165313f9461f663 Mon Sep 17 00:00:00 2001 From: Marius Iacob Date: Tue, 28 Apr 2020 17:18:32 +0300 Subject: [PATCH] Using pango markup for status text Use a single font string. Removed some utf8 code from drw. Created for pango 1.44. Older versions might not have getter for font height, ascent + descent can be used instead. All texts are rendered with pango but only status is with markup. Doubled stext size (in case a lot of markup is used).
